Carbon Fairings
Carbon fairings replace heavy stock bodywork with autoclave-cured composite panels built for one purpose: less weight where it matters. Our carbon fairings collection covers full race fairing kits and individual body panels from Fullsix, Carbonin and AP Carbon Line, developed for platforms like the Ducati Panigale, BMW S1000RR, Yamaha R1 and Kawasaki ZX-10R. Whether you are stripping a bike for trackdays, building a race machine to championship regulations, or upgrading a road bike with genuine motorsport components, the difference to painted plastic is immediate — in mass, stiffness and finish.
When choosing, start with the layup. Prepreg, autoclave-cured carbon offers the best strength-to-weight ratio and a consistent resin content; twill and plain weaves differ mainly in appearance and drapability around complex curves. Decide between a complete race fairing — typically a one- or two-piece upper with belly pan, designed for quick removal and fastener kits — and street-legal panels that retain mounts for lights and mirrors. Check compatibility with your subframe, radiator and exhaust routing, especially on bikes running full race systems.
Finish matters too: clear-coated gloss or matte carbon can be run as delivered, while unpainted race surfaces are intended for livery paintwork. Every fairing here is model-specific, so verify your exact generation and model year before ordering — mounting points shift between updates even when the silhouette looks unchanged.
